Coming up very soon is one of our city's favourite community events, the Blackwood Rotary Christmas Fair, which will be held on Sunday November 15th at Karinya Reserve in Eden Hill. If Christmas shopping is on your mind at the moment, be sure to mark this event into your weekly calendar.

Image courtesy of Andy Mabbett / Wikimedia Commons
Blackwood Rotary Christmas Fair is celebrating its 40th anniversary this year and is bigger and better than ever before, with loads of fabulous community stalls taking part on the big day. All the classic fair-time favourites will be there - plants, second hand books, bric-a-brac, gourmet food, loads of gorgeous handmade wares and much, much more. Family entertainment on the day will be a Coast FM Live Broadcast, Blackwood High School singers and the Mitcham City Brass Band. There will be plenty of children's entertainment as well, including a bouncy castle, Farmer Darcy's Travelling farm, Clancy the Jelly Bean Train and quite a few other fun surprises. Father Christmas will even be making an appearance.
In a nutshell, whether you're a veteran fair-lover, have an active young family to entertain, or want to find some special Christmas presents for your loved-ones, this year's Blackwood Rotary Community Fair promises to be a great day out with something for everyone. Taking place from 9am until 3pm on Sunday November 15th 2015, it will be held at Karinya Reserve on Shepherds Hill Road in Eden Hills.
